New Star Trek Game Demo Reveals Choices, Challenges Ahead
UPDATE: The highly anticipated demo for Star Trek: Voyager: Across the Unknown has just been released during the Steam Next Fest, captivating fans with its promise of choice-driven gameplay. Players assume command of the starship Voyager after it is propelled 70,000 light-years into the Delta Quadrant, facing critical decisions that will determine the fate of the crew and the ship.
The demo immerses players in the opening narrative based on the series pilot, “Caretaker,” where they must manage resources, engage in conflict, and maintain crew morale. Initial impressions suggest a promising framework, yet many players feel the tutorial confines choices, limiting the impact of pivotal decisions.
In the demo, players navigate familiar events, including encounters with the Kazon and the mysterious Ocampa planet. Choices made during missions, such as rescuing crew members or engaging in combat, initially seem impactful. However, the demo’s structure has raised concerns that it may prioritize guidance over genuine choice-making, leading to a sense of being on a predetermined path.
One player attempted to steer the narrative in an unconventional direction by making reckless decisions as Captain Janeway, neglecting ship management and sending inadequately prepared away teams on dangerous missions. Despite these efforts, the demo’s design led to a failure state, forcing a reload rather than allowing for lasting consequences on the storyline.
Gamers have expressed a mix of excitement and caution as they explore the demo’s mechanics. While resource management shines in this early phase, concerns linger about the depth of choice available in the full game. Players eagerly await confirmation of how the final product will enhance or limit their ability to shape Voyager’s journey home.
